HPNA:高性能网络体系结构
“高性能网络体系结构”(High Performance Network Architecture,简称HPNA)是计算机硬件领域的一个重要技术术语,指代旨在实现高效数据传输和低延迟通信的网络架构设计。为了方便书写与日常使用,该术语常缩写为HPNA。此类架构广泛应用于数据中心、超级计算等对网络性能有严苛要求的场景,以确保系统能够稳定、快速地处理海量数据交换任务。
